Originally from Novi, Michigan, he obtained his Bachelor of
Arts degree in psychology from Rutgers University in New
Brunswick, New Jersey. He received a Master of Arts degree
and Doctor of Clinical Psychology (Psy.D.) degree from the
Georgia School of Professional Psychology of Argosy
University in Atlanta, Georgia.
With over 15 years of clinical experience beginning as far back
as high school, he has had the opportunity to work with many
individuals and families, and with a wide range of ages,
cultures, and backgrounds. As a psychologist his primary goal
is to support the individual or family, and as a team member,
offer guidance that could lead to better functioning in many
areas of life. He emphasizes the importance of a safe and
nonjudgmental atmosphere.
Dr. Bank is a clinical psychologist working in Athens, GA. He
provides individual therapy with children and adolescents, as
well as psychological evaluations (i.e., intellectual, emotional,
and behavioral). His areas of specialty include emotional and
behavioral disorders of early childhood, behavior
modification, anger management, adjustment disorders,
depression, and anxiety.
